2025年VFP课程内容整合试题及答案_第1页
2025年VFP课程内容整合试题及答案_第2页
2025年VFP课程内容整合试题及答案_第3页
2025年VFP课程内容整合试题及答案_第4页
2025年VFP课程内容整合试题及答案_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2025年VFP课程内容整合试题及答案姓名:____________________

一、单项选择题(每题2分,共10题)

1.VisualFoxPro是一种______。

A.高级语言

B.数据库管理系统

C.程序设计语言

D.编译器

2.在VisualFoxPro中,一个表可以包含______。

A.一个字段

B.任意多个字段

C.最多10个字段

D.最少1个字段

3.在VisualFoxPro中,要修改一个表的结构,可以使用______命令。

A.MODIFYTABLE

B.ALTERTABLE

C.EDITTABLE

D.MODIFYVIEW

4.以下关于VisualFoxPro查询的说法,正确的是______。

A.查询只能从一个表中获取数据

B.查询只能从多个表中获取数据

C.查询可以从一个或多个表中获取数据

D.查询只能获取表中的数据

5.在VisualFoxPro中,要设置一个字段为必填字段,可以使用______属性。

A.NOTNULL

B.UNIQUE

C.PRIMARYKEY

D.DEFAULT

6.以下关于VisualFoxPro索引的说法,错误的是______。

A.索引可以加快数据检索速度

B.索引可以提高数据输入速度

C.索引可以确保数据的唯一性

D.索引可以保证数据的完整性

7.在VisualFoxPro中,要创建一个新表,可以使用______命令。

A.CREATETABLE

B.NEWTABLE

C.TABLENEW

D.TABLECREATE

8.以下关于VisualFoxPro视图的说法,正确的是______。

A.视图是虚拟的表,不包含数据

B.视图是物理的表,包含数据

C.视图可以包含一个或多个表的数据

D.视图不能包含其他视图的数据

9.在VisualFoxPro中,要删除一个字段,可以使用______命令。

A.DELETECOLUMN

B.DROPCOLUMN

C.REMOVECOLUMN

D.ERASECOLUMN

10.以下关于VisualFoxPro数据库的说法,正确的是______。

A.数据库是存储数据的容器

B.数据库可以包含多个表

C.数据库可以包含多个视图

D.数据库只能包含一个表

二、多项选择题(每题3分,共5题)

1.VisualFoxPro的特点包括______。

A.界面友好

B.支持面向对象编程

C.支持多种数据库连接

D.支持多种编程语言

2.在VisualFoxPro中,以下关于字段的说法,正确的是______。

A.字段可以包含多种数据类型

B.字段可以有默认值

C.字段可以有有效性规则

D.字段可以有索引

3.以下关于索引的说法,正确的是______。

A.索引可以提高数据检索速度

B.索引可以确保数据的唯一性

C.索引可以保证数据的完整性

D.索引可以加快数据输入速度

4.以下关于查询的说法,正确的是______。

A.查询可以从一个或多个表中获取数据

B.查询可以筛选数据

C.查询可以排序数据

D.查询可以更新数据

5.以下关于数据库的说法,正确的是______。

A.数据库是存储数据的容器

B.数据库可以包含多个表

C.数据库可以包含多个视图

D.数据库可以包含多个索引

二、多项选择题(每题3分,共10题)

1.在VisualFoxPro中,以下关于表结构的说法,正确的是:

A.表结构定义了表中的字段

B.表结构定义了字段的属性

C.表结构定义了索引

D.表结构定义了视图

2.以下关于VisualFoxPro编程语言的特点,正确的是:

A.支持过程式编程

B.支持面向对象编程

C.支持事件驱动编程

D.支持函数式编程

3.在VisualFoxPro中,以下关于数据类型,正确的是:

A.字符型(Character)

B.数值型(Numeric)

C.日期型(Date)

D.逻辑型(Logical)

4.以下关于VisualFoxPro中的索引类型,正确的是:

A.单索引

B.复合索引

C.候选索引

D.临时索引

5.在VisualFoxPro中,以下关于查询设计器的说法,正确的是:

A.查询设计器可以创建SELECT查询

B.查询设计器可以创建UPDATE查询

C.查询设计器可以创建DELETE查询

D.查询设计器可以创建INSERT查询

6.以下关于VisualFoxPro中的表单,正确的是:

A.表单是用户界面的一部分

B.表单可以包含控件

C.表单可以包含数据环境

D.表单可以包含事件和方法

7.在VisualFoxPro中,以下关于类和对象的说法,正确的是:

A.类是对象的模板

B.对象是类的实例

C.类可以包含属性和方法

D.对象可以调用类的方法

8.以下关于VisualFoxPro中的程序设计,正确的是:

A.程序由多个程序文件组成

B.程序文件包含程序代码

C.程序代码可以包含过程和函数

D.程序可以包含事件和事件处理程序

9.在VisualFoxPro中,以下关于数据库的备份和恢复,正确的是:

A.可以使用COPY命令备份数据库

B.可以使用RESTORE命令恢复数据库

C.数据库备份可以是物理备份

D.数据库备份可以是逻辑备份

10.以下关于VisualFoxPro中的数据管理,正确的是:

A.可以使用BROWSE命令浏览表数据

B.可以使用REPLACE命令更新表数据

C.可以使用APPEND命令添加新数据

D.可以使用DELETE命令删除数据

三、判断题(每题2分,共10题)

1.VisualFoxPro是一种面向对象的编程语言。()

2.在VisualFoxPro中,每个字段只能有一个索引。()

3.查询的结果可以直接保存为表。()

4.视图可以包含一个或多个表的数据,但不能包含其他视图的数据。()

5.在VisualFoxPro中,表单是用户界面的一部分,只能包含控件。()

6.在VisualFoxPro中,一个类可以有多个对象实例。()

7.VisualFoxPro中的程序文件必须以.PRG为扩展名。()

8.在VisualFoxPro中,可以使用SQL语句操作数据库。()

9.VisualFoxPro支持多种数据库连接,如ODBC、ADO等。()

10.在VisualFoxPro中,可以使用命令行工具进行数据库备份和恢复。()

四、简答题(每题5分,共6题)

1.简述VisualFoxPro中创建表的基本步骤。

2.解释在VisualFoxPro中索引的作用及其类型。

3.描述如何使用查询设计器创建一个简单的SELECT查询。

4.简要说明在VisualFoxPro中如何管理表单和控件。

5.解释VisualFoxPro中数据环境的作用及其配置方法。

6.列举至少三种VisualFoxPro中的数据类型,并简要说明它们的特点。

试卷答案如下

一、单项选择题答案及解析思路:

1.B:VisualFoxPro是一种数据库管理系统。

2.B:一个表可以包含任意多个字段。

3.A:使用MODIFYTABLE命令可以修改表的结构。

4.C:查询可以从一个或多个表中获取数据。

5.A:使用NOTNULL属性设置字段为必填字段。

6.B:索引不能提高数据输入速度。

7.A:使用CREATETABLE命令创建新表。

8.C:视图可以包含一个或多个表的数据。

9.B:使用DROPCOLUMN命令删除字段。

10.A:数据库是存储数据的容器。

二、多项选择题答案及解析思路:

1.ABC:VisualFoxPro的特点包括界面友好、支持面向对象编程、支持多种数据库连接。

2.ABCD:字段可以包含多种数据类型、可以有默认值、有效性规则和索引。

3.ABC:索引可以提高数据检索速度、确保数据的唯一性和完整性。

4.ABCD:查询设计器可以创建SELECT、UPDATE、DELETE和INSERT查询。

5.ABCD:表单可以包含控件、数据环境、事件和方法。

6.ABCD:类是对象的模板、对象是类的实例、类可以包含属性和方法、对象可以调用类的方法。

7.ABCD:程序由多个程序文件组成、程序文件包含程序代码、程序代码可以包含过程和函数、程序可以包含事件和事件处理程序。

8.ABCD:可以使用COPY命令备份数据库、可以使用RESTORE命令恢复数据库、数据库备份可以是物理备份和逻辑备份。

9.ABCD:可以使用BROWSE命令浏览表数据、可以使用REPLACE命令更新表数据、可以使用APPEND命令添加新数据、可以使用DELETE命令删除数据。

三、判断题答案及解析思路:

1.×:VisualFoxPro是一种数据库管理系统,不是编程语言。

2.×:每个字段可以有多个索引,包括主索引和候选索引。

3.√:查询的结果可以直接保存为表。

4.×:视图可以包含一个或多个表的数据,也可以包含其他视图的数据。

5.×:表单可以包含控件、数据环境、事件和方法,不仅仅是控件。

6.√:一个类可以有多个对象实例。

7.√:VisualFoxPro中的程序文件必须以.PRG为扩展名。

8.√:VisualFoxPro支持使用SQL语句操作数据库。

9.√:VisualFoxPro支持多种数据库连接,如ODBC、ADO等。

10.√:在VisualFoxPro中,可以使用命令行工具进行数据库备份和恢复。

四、简答题答案及解析思路:

1.创建表的基本步骤包括:选择数据库、打开表设计器、定义字段、设置字段属性、设置索引、保存表结构。

2.索引的作用是提高数据检索速度,索引类型包括单索引、复合索引、候选索引和临时索引。

3.使用查询设计器创建SELECT查询的步骤包括:打开查询设计器、选择要查询的表或视图、选择字段、设置查询条件、排

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论